§43-551-301. Definitions.

43 OK Stat § 43-551-301 (2016) What's This?

DEFINITIONS

In this article:

1. "Petitioner" means a person who seeks enforcement of an order for return of a child under the Hague Convention on the Civil Aspects of International Child Abduction or enforcement of a child custody determination.

2. "Respondent" means a person against whom a proceeding has been commenced for enforcement of an order for return of a child under the Hague Convention on the Civil Aspects of International Child Abduction or enforcement of a child custody determination.

Added by Laws 1998, c. 407, § 23, eff. Nov. 1, 1998.
